Cataclysm: Dark Days Ahead is a free, open-source turn-based survival game set in a post-apocalyptic world. The game drops you into a procedurally generated world where civilization has collapsed, and you have to find food, supplies, and shelter while dealing with zombies, giant insects, killer robots, and other threats. The world persists between play sessions, so choices you make have lasting consequences. The game has two visual modes: a tiles version with graphical sprites and an older text-based terminal version using characters to represent everything on screen. Both run on Windows, macOS, and Linux. Pre-built downloads are available on the official website and through several Linux package managers including Arch Linux, Fedora, Debian/Ubuntu, and Flatpak. If you want to build from source instead of downloading a release, the repository includes detailed compilation guides for Linux, macOS, Windows with MSYS2, Windows with Visual Studio, and a CMake path. The codebase is written in C++ and has been in active development for many years, with over 1000 contributors. The project is community-driven and releases both stable builds and more frequent experimental builds with the latest changes. Contributing is welcome: code, game content, translations, and bug reports all go through the GitHub repository. The license is Creative Commons Attribution ShareAlike 3.0, which means the game and all its content can be freely used and modified. An in-game tutorial is available from the main menu, and pressing the question mark key during play opens a help reference with all key bindings.
